A survey on level set methods for inverse problems and optimal design
The aim of this paper is to provide a survey on the recent development in level set methods
in inverse problems and optimal design. We give introductions on the general features of
such problems involving geometries and on the general framework of the level set method.
In subsequent parts we discuss shape sensitivity analysis and its relation to level set
methods, various approaches on constructing optimization algorithms based on the level
set approach, and special tools needed for the application of level set based optimization
methods to ill-posed problems. Furthermore, we provide a review on numerical methods
important in this context, and give an overview of applications treated with level set
methods.
